Job Description

THOR Solutions is actively seeking a juniorlevel Logistician with U.S. Navy shipboard experience to provide fulltime support for U.S. Naval shipboard elevator/conveyor systems at theMidAtlantic Regional Maintenance Center (MARMC)inNorfolk VA. An ideal candidate will have completed at least one shipboard tour in a logistics parts or supplyrelated role.

Typical Responsibilities:
  • Provide Integrated Logistics Support (ILS) for Cargo/Weapons Elevators Aircraft Elevators Deck Edge Doors Hanger Bay Divisional Doors Vertical Package Conveyors and other assigned equipment.
  • Accompany elevator assessors aboard U.S. Navy ships and confirm that shipboard elevator/conveyor configurations match technical documentation.
  • Complete material readiness assessment reports as defined by the Joint Fleet Maintenance Manual (JFMM) Vol. IV Chapter 8.

Location:Onsite at MidAtlantic Regional Maintenance Center (MARMC) in Norfolk VA.

Typical Physical Activity:Mix of desk/computer work in an office environment and visits to waterfront/shipboard environments. May involve: repetitive motion traversing shipboard environments (e.g. confined spaces ladders hatches) or vision.

Security Clearance Eligibility Required:This position requires a DoD Secret security clearance. A qualified candidate must either already possess an active or interim Secret security clearance (highly preferred); OR be eligible for a new Secret security clearance prior to start.

Typical Knowledge Skills and Abilities:
  • High school diploma/GED equivalent applicable military A or C school or other relevant vocational training.
  • At least three 3 years of recent relevant experience with U.S. Navy shipboard Integrated Logistics Support (ILS) for Cargo/Weapons Elevators Aircraft Elevators Deck Edge Doors Hanger Bay Divisional Doors Vertical Package Conveyors and other assigned equipment.
    • Ideal experience includes at least one shipboard tour preferably on an amphib and/or a machinist mate parts PO.
  • Be familiar with elevator door and conveyor terminologies and configurations.
  • Proficient with common productivity software such as the Microsoft Office suite.
  • Strong communication skills.
